tool box repairs

Has anybody r and r the drawer slides on a Maximiser tool box? I removed the drawer with no problems, just a twist here and a pull there..and out it came. Now I am struggling with removing the slider from the box. My main goal is to not damage the box, so if any body has any tricks I would be open to suggestions. Thank you.

I've done mine on my shitty Costco toolbox. I removed the drawer and then located the rivets that hold the slider to the box through the sliding piece. Drilled out the rivets and out it came
